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els

FrontbrakesSingle disc
FrontsuspensionTelescopic, cartridge-type, oil-damped, adjustable preload, 14-way compression damping and 18-way rebound damping
Fronttyre80/70-21
RearbrakesSingle disc
RearsuspensionLink-type, fully-adjustable spring preload, adjustable high/low compression dampimg and adjustable rebound damping
Reartyre110/90-18

Engine & Transmission

Borexstroke90.0 x 62.6 mm (3.5 x 2.5 inches)
CoolingsystemLiquid
Displacement398.00 ccm (24.29 cubic inches)
EnginedetailsSingle cylinder, four-stroke
FuelsystemCarburettor. Mikuni BSR36
Gearbox5-speed
IgnitionDigital/DC-CDI
LubricationsystemWet sump
Valvespercylinder4

Physical Measures & Capacities

Dryweight119.0 kg (262.4 pounds)
Fuelcapacity10.00 litres (2.64 gallons)
Groundclearance325 mm (12.8 inches)
Overalllength2,235 mm (88.0 inches)
Overallwidth825 mm (32.5 inches)
Seatheight945 mm (37.2 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ting.

About Suzuki DR-Z 400 E 2007

Introducing the 2007 Suzuki DR-Z 400 E: A Trailblazer in Enduro Riding

The 2007 Suzuki DR-Z 400 E is a formidable contender in the enduro-offroad category, designed for riders who crave adventure both on and off the beaten path. With a price of US$ 5,199, this versatile machine strikes a perfect balance between performance and accessibility, making it a favorite among both seasoned riders and newcomers alike. Known for its robust build and reliable performance, the DR-Z 400 E is ready to conquer rugged terrains, whether you're navigating through dense forests or tackling rocky trails.

Engine Performance and Riding Characteristics

At the heart of the DR-Z 400 E lies a powerful 398 cc single-cylinder, four-stroke engine that delivers an exhilarating riding experience. With a bore and stroke of 90.0 x 62.6 mm, this engine generates a responsive throttle and unmistakable torque, ensuring that riders can tackle steep inclines and tricky descents with confidence. The digital DC-CDI ignition and liquid cooling system enhance performance and reliability, allowing for smooth operation even in the harshest conditions. Paired with a 5-speed gearbox, the DR-Z 400 E offers seamless transitions between gears, making it a joy to ride on both technical trails and open roads.

Key Features and Technology

The DR-Z 400 E is equipped with cutting-edge features that elevate the riding experience. The advanced suspension system includes a telescopic, cartridge-type front suspension that boasts adjustable preload and 14-way compression damping, coupled with a rear-link type suspension that offers fully adjustable spring preload and rebound damping. This setup provides stellar handling and comfort over rough terrain. With a ground clearance of 325 mm and a seat height of 945 mm, the DR-Z 400 E accommodates a variety of rider sizes, while its lightweight design of 119 kg (262.4 pounds) ensures agility and maneuverability. The bike's 10-liter fuel tank allows for extended rides, making it an ideal companion for long-distance trail adventures.

Pros and Cons

Pros:

  1. Powerful Engine: The 398 cc engine delivers strong performance and reliable torque, ideal for offroad adventures.
  2. Adjustable Suspension: The fully adjustable front and rear suspension allows riders to customize their setup for optimal comfort and handling.
  3. Lightweight Design: At just 119 kg, the DR-Z 400 E is nimble and easy to maneuver, enhancing its off-road capability.

Cons:

  1. Seat Height: The relatively high seat height may be challenging for shorter riders to manage comfortably.
  2. Limited Fuel Capacity: While 10 liters is decent, some riders may find it insufficient for very long rides without frequent refueling.
  3. Basic Instrumentation: The bike's instrumentation is straightforward and may lack advanced features that some modern riders prefer.
